About this vintage design furniture
This rosewood sideboard was designed by Rudolf B. Glatzel for Fristho NV Franeker - Netherlands 1960s. The rosewood features a prominent wood grain, with front doors displaying graphicallly arranged rosewood veneer. The doors have hidden handles on the top margins. Spacious interior in maple, with shelves and trays, the brushed steel legs are braced with laminated plywood. In good condition.

About the designer
Rudolf Bernd GLATZEL
Rudolf Bernd Glatzel was a German industrial designer born in 1922 in Breslau (today Wrocław, Poland) and died in 2005 in Darmstadt, Germany.
